Diagnosis

A mesothelioma diagnosis requires an array of testing methods. Doctors look over your medical history and perform an examination to look for symptoms. They may also use blood markers and imaging tests to determine mesothelioma. A tissue biopsy is the only method of making an accurate diagnosis of mesothelioma, but it is often not the first test that doctors do.

Mesothelioma is most common in the pleura, or lining around the lungs and chest cavity. The most frequent symptoms of mesothelioma pleural is the presence of fluids in the chest cavity, referred to as pleural effusion. This can be seen in a chest CT scan or X-ray. It also aids doctors in determining the best place to biopsy.

For a mesothelioma biopsy doctors can make use of a needle or surgery to remove a small portion of the affected tissue. The biopsy is then examined under a microscope to determine if the cells in the sample are cancerous. The cells of mesothelioma are divided into three distinct kinds, based on their appearance under a microscope. These include epithelioid (epidermoid), Sarcomatoid (sarcomatoid) and mixed (biphasic).

Depending on the type of mesothelioma and the symptoms you are experiencing, doctors can suggest a variety of scans or blood tests. A complete blood count (CBC) measures the levels of white and red blood cells, as well as platelets. It can aid doctors in identifying signs of mesothelioma such as increased levels of an enzyme known as Lactate Dehydrogenase.

An echocardiogram is a special form of ultrasound that shows how well the heart functions. It is typically used to diagnose pericardial mesothelioma which affects the lining of the heart.

A chest CT scan uses x-rays computers and a computer program to create an image of your lung. It can aid doctors in identifying mesothelioma cancers and determine how the thickness of the tissue is.

A pleural mesothelioma diagnosis may require lung function tests or pulmonary function test to determine if the lungs are working. A flexible tube called a "bronchoscope" is put into the throat or mouth and down the airway. The bronchoscope is fitted with a camera and may be connected to a huge monitor so that doctors can see the lungs and the surrounding area. The test can take between 30 and 60 minutes.

Treatment

Treatment options for mesothelioma is dependent on the type and stage of cancer. Patients should select a mesothelioma expert who is experienced with the disease and can discuss their treatment goals. This is known as shared decision-making.

Chest Xrays are often the first imaging test the doctor of a patient orders. These tests can reveal changes to the lung's lining, such as thickening and the buildup of fluid. They can also reveal whether mesothelioma cancer has spread to other parts of the body. Other testing can include an CT scan, an MRI and an PET (positron emission tomography) scan. The tests for blood can also reveal the presence of certain chemicals associated with mesothelioma.


If mesothelioma is diagnosed, doctors will order an invasive biopsy. This involves removing one small portion of the lining to look at under a microscope for mesothelioma cells. Doctors can obtain the tissue sample via VATS (video assisted thoracoscopic surgical) or a keyhole type surgery. It is also possible to use a CT guided core biopsy which uses an needle guided by images taken from a CT scan. A biopsy can be used to determine the type of cell in mesothelioma. This will affect the way that cancer responds. Epithelioid mesothelioma cells respond the best to treatment, while mixed cell and sarcomatoid types are not.

The most popular mesothelioma treatments are chemotherapy, surgery and radiation therapy. These treatments can increase a patient's lifespan by 30-40%. In certain cases doctors may suggest immunotherapy. These drugs boost the patient's own immune system to fight off cancer. These drugs can be combined with other treatments like chemotherapy and surgery.

Mesothelioma patients must always think about participating in a clinical study since it can result in more effective and innovative treatments. Researchers conduct these trials to find new ways to treat the disease and improve the lives of patients.

Treatment for mesothelioma that is advanced seeks to lessen symptoms and ensure they are under control. These symptoms include pain, breathlessness and swelling. Breathing problems can be alleviated by surgical procedures such as an pleura drain. If you are not able to undergo surgery, a home treatment such as TTFields might be suggested.
